After the Disaster Response and Recovery 

On Tuesday, October 24, 2017, the Redwood Valley Municipal Advisory Council (MAC) in partnership with Mendocino County First District Supervisor Carre Brown, will hold an informational meeting to educate and assist individuals, families and businesses affected by the Redwood Fire. Mendocino County will provide an update on disaster recovery efforts and available services from local, state, federal and non-profit partners.

When: Tuesday, October 24, 2017 from 6:00 p.m. to 8:00 p.m.

Where: Eagle Peak Middle School Gymnasium, 8601 West Rd, Redwood Valley CA 95470

Live Online: This community meeting will be streamed live on the Mendocino County Facebook page and YouTube Channel.

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) Disaster Services Assistance workers will be available onsite from 5:00 p.m. – 6:00 p.m to assist with FEMA claim registration. Claimants may also register online at https://www.fema.gov/apply-assistance. FEMA services and additional resources will continue to be available at the Local Assistance Center (LAC) located at Mendocino College (1000 Hensley Creek Rd) in Ukiah from 10 a.m. to 7 p.m. daily through October 30, 2017.
